Shereka Girl
Name Meaning & Origin Pronunciation: shuh-REE-kah /ʃəˈriːkə/
Origin: African American; English
Meaning: unknown; possibly a modern creation
Historical & Cultural Background
The name Shereka is believed to be a modern invention, likely derived from a combination of existing names or elements within various linguistic traditions. Its etymological roots can be traced to the African American Vernacular English (AAVE) context, where names often reflect a blend of cultural influences and personal significance.
The name may incorporate elements from names like 'Sheri' or 'Sharon,' which have Hebrew origins, meaning 'a plain' or 'a song,' respectively, combined with a suffix that adds a unique flair, characteristic of many contemporary names. This linguistic evolution reflects the broader trend of name creation in the 20th century, particularly within African American communities, where unique names serve as markers of identity and heritage.
Historically, the emergence of names like Shereka can be contextualized within the African American experience, particularly during the Civil Rights Movement of the 1960s and the subsequent cultural renaissance that celebrated Black identity and creativity. This period saw an increase in the use of distinctive names as a form of self-expression and cultural pride.
While Shereka itself may not have notable historical figures or saints associated with it, it embodies the spirit of innovation in naming practices that arose during this transformative era. Culturally, names like Shereka resonate with themes of individuality and empowerment, reflecting the desire for uniqueness in a society that often emphasizes conformity.
The name's melodic quality and distinctive spelling contribute to its appeal, making it a symbol of cultural identity. While diminutive forms or variations may exist, Shereka stands out as a representation of a broader movement towards embracing and celebrating diverse naming traditions.
This name, therefore, not only serves as a personal identifier but also as a reflection of the rich tapestry of cultural influences that shape contemporary naming practices.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Shereka was first seen in the United States in 1972.
Shereka has ranked as high as #1075 nationally, which occurred in 1983, and has been most popular in North Carolina, Georgia, Texas, Alabama, and Florida.
In the past 5 years the name Shereka has been trending down compared to the previous 5 years.

Popularity Over Time (National) — Table
We track the national popularity of each baby name annually. The table below displays each year along with the number of births reported by the Social Security Administration. This data combines all state-level reporting from the SSA's baby names database to provide a comprehensive view of overall birth counts for Shereka.
| Year | Births |
|---|---|
| 1996 | 6 |
| 1995 | 10 |
| 1994 | 7 |
| 1993 | 5 |
| 1992 | 9 |
| 1991 | 17 |
| 1990 | 20 |
| 1989 | 20 |
| 1988 | 17 |
| 1987 | 27 |
| 1986 | 30 |
| 1985 | 28 |
| 1984 | 22 |
| 1983 | 41 |
| 1982 | 20 |
| 1981 | 40 |
| 1980 | 37 |
| 1979 | 36 |
| 1978 | 35 |
| 1977 | 10 |
| 1976 | 19 |
| 1975 | 16 |
| 1974 | 14 |
| 1973 | 9 |
| 1972 | 6 |
